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4205195202 659 753302
15 4676422230 4708
15 4676422230 4708
0343602 66 6257963294 23522 86
All about undefined
Interested in learning more?
15 4676422230 4708
0343602 66 6257963294 23522 86
See more
1604704 59429766504 574
68426 162969 17684 6242192
See more
491 89483829247 1680244
18094078396 103 8968673
See more